ESBI Computing will be exhibiting and presenting a paper on "National Flood Hazard Mapping" at the upcoming GIS Ireland 2005 event. Aisling Horgan, Project Manager for the National Flood Hazard Mapping solution will present on ESBI & ESBI Computing developing a complete Flood Hazard Mapping GIS and database for The Office of Public Works (OPW). The project is divided into two major parts:
The first part is the delivery of a public Internet and Extranet GIS solution, which includes the ability to do the following:
- Comprehensive database searching and reporting
- Interaction with a comprehensive range of mapping through Web GIS
- Viewing of historic flood events and flood information as maps, photographs, press
cuttings and reports
- Data Management facilities
- Data download functionality for registered users via an Extranet.
The second major part is collection of all information on historical flood events in the country, which involves:
- Sourcing all flood related data across 58 public bodies
- Collection of flood protection asset information and existing predictive flood information
- Data digitisation, interpretation and verification
The total project will be delivered in 4 stages over 5 years, and involves complete support and maintenance of the system during this period. The project involves managing a diverse range of stakeholders and stakeholder interests.
GIS Ireland 2005 will take place in Croke Park Stadium in Dublin on the 18th of October 2005.
